  1. Planning the Garden

Will you start with clones or seeds? Deciding this will change the manner and timing by which the plants get introduced to the outdoors. Plants that grow from seeds are more vigorous and heartier than clones. The fact is that they produce a stronger taproot. For clones, it is impossible to replicate.

The vigor becomes advantageous while dealing with adverse environmental conditions. Additional attention is necessary for germinating seedlings. Besides, there’s a demand for eliminating the males before they start pollinating females and high variability in growth resulting from the genes.

Whether you’re starting from clones or seeds, many cultivators grow their plants indoors to ensure they do not get exposed to adverse weather conditions. Extending the vegetative growth period indoors will also help increase the yields and enable grower time to choose the most effective plants that require moving to the external climate.

  1. Embracing Mother Nature

Calling it a hardy plant to have adapted to different types of climates worldwide is not an exaggeration. It’s susceptible to crucial weather conditions. Whether heavy winds or excessive rain, an excellent exterior will also bring some challenges. But you can avoid them very simply.

All you need is to become intimately familiar with the local seasons and climate for producing high-quality marijuana. Learn the outdoor temperature to thrive the light’s intensity and amount, site, and optimal time.

Cultivars might vary, but the general thumb’s rule will remain intact. That stated, the daytime temperatures must range from 75 to 85 degrees Fahrenheit. Temperatures over 88 degrees Fahrenheit or under 60 degrees Fahrenheit delay the growth. The plant is heat-tolerant, although extreme lows and sustained highs result in complications to kill it.

During the season’s first half, the usual daytime period will increase until the summer solstice. With the increase in daylight hours, the vegetative stage of the plant occurs. During vegetation, cannabis plants develop stems and roots that serve as a foundation for growth before flowering occurs.

Thus, it is imperative to plan the planting schedule and ensure the plants complete the flowering period before rain or cold.

  1. Selecting the Appropriate Site

Choosing the right site for growing cannabis is a crucial parameter that affects the quality and yield of the plant. Northern Hemisphere cultivators must attempt placing the plants in the area with southern exposure. This will ensure the plants get the most sunlight. If the climate you reside in is exceptionally sunny and hot, you can shade cloth to prevent the plants from getting overheated. In cold regions, cement, brick walls, or natural enclosures may retain the available heat and keep the plants warm.

Whether or not you need to plan for rain entirely depends on the location. The rainy season gets aligned with the flowering stage’s end and the harvesting period’s beginning. It might not always happen.

Rain becomes detrimental to the flowering crop. Preparing for covering or moving the plants can also help ensure a fruitful harvest. When it rains on the plants, it is imperative to ensure that you shake off the excess water. This is because excessive moisture leads to mold formation, thereby ruining the harvest.

  1. What Media and Containers to Use

Quality soil is dark and rich in nutrients, and its texture is fluffy and light. The soil structure must retain water while allowing for drainage. The organic soil blends from local garden centers can be excellent. Seasoned growers always choose to blend their organic soil on their own. The soil should have a six pH level. 

As for the containers, always refrain from using clay pots because they are heavy and expensive. They retain heat that dries out the roots and soil. The most effective solution is using fabric pots, for they allow plenty of drainage and oxygen to reach the roots.

It requires a bit of preparation to plant directly into grounds or raised beds. Without the container that restricts growth, roots grow thick and deep. Also, it develops support for the strong plant. The surface area allows it to access a solid quantity of water and nutrients into the soil compared to the container garden.

Besides that, avoiding all-in-one fertilizers is imperative because they are high in nitrogen. They may also damage the plant at their flowering stage and kill good microorganisms in the soil. You can use organic nutrient sources like bone meal, alfalfa meal, bat guano, kelp meal, dolomite, fish emulsion, as well as earthworm castings.
